Quad Cities Red Kettle Campaign fall short of goal

The Salvation Army says last week’s snow storm is one of the factors that kept them from reaching their Red Kettle goal.

The Dispatch/Rock Island Argus reported that last week’s snow storm may have cost The Salvation Army’s Red Kettle Campaign at least $12,000.

As of Monday night, the Salvation Army goal for this year’s campaign was $185,00 short of its $725,000 goal.

The physical red kettles have been pulled from their locations but the campaign isn’t over. You can mail contributions to the Salvation Army at the address below or you can call 1-800-SAL-ARMY (or 725-2769) to make a credit card donation.

The Salvation Army will take donations through mid-January.
